Vet Tech Degree Options

Muscoy California vet checking dog's blood pressure

One of the first decisions that you will need to make is if you plan to train as a vet technician, assistant or technologist. Part of your decision might be dependent on the amount of time and money that you have to commit to your training, but the primary determiner will undoubtedly be which specialization appeals to you the most. What technicians and assistants share in common is that they all work under the direct supervision of a licensed and practicing veterinarian. And even though there are numerous duties that they can perform within the Muscoy CA veterinary clinic or hospital, they can't prescribe medicines, diagnose conditions, or conduct surgical procedures. In those areas they may only provide assistance to a licensed vet. There are technicians and technologists that work outside of the standard vet practice, such as for zoos, animal shelters or law enforcement. Let's take a look at the duties and training requirements for each specialization.

  • Vet Assistants in almost all instances will have undergone a structured training program, either as an apprentice or intern in a vet clinic or hospital, or by completing a certificate program at a vocational school or community college. As the name implies, their job function is to assist the vets and vet techs in the execution of their duties. Normally they are not involved with more complex activities, for instance assisting with surgeries. Some of their normal duties may include working at the front desk, cleaning and preparing examination rooms and equipment, or handling pets during exams.
  • Vet Technicians receive more advanced training in contrast to assistants and typically obtain a two year Associate Degree, preferably from an American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A) accredited program. They are in a fashion the vet counterparts of medical nurses, since their basic job duty is to assist vets with diagnosing and treating animal patients. Where they vary from vet assistants is that they are engaged in more involved tasks, for example assisting with surgeries or providing medication. All states presently mandate that veterinary techs pass a credentialing exam for either registration, certification or licensing.
  • Vet Technologists are comparable to vet techs and essentially perform the same work functions. They are required to earn a Bachelor's Degree in veterinary technology, which generally requires 4 years. So the only real difference between a vet technician and a technologist is the technologist's higher level of education. But with an advanced degree comes more job opportunities, increased salaries and possible management positions. They are also mandated to pass a credentialing exam for either licensing, registration or certification.

Vet technicians and technologists can specialize in areas such as anesthesia, internal medicine or emergency care. Some may receive certification from the American Association for Laboratory Animal Science (AALAS) to work in  Muscoy CA labs or research facilities also.

Veterinary Technician Online Schools Available

Muscoy California female student taking vet tech courses onlineAn option that might be a solution for those with a hectic lifestyle or who are working full-time while going to veterinary school is to enroll in an online program. Since the classes are provided by means of the internet, students can attend on their own timetable wherever a computer is available. The course of study is taught using multiple methods, including slide shows, videos and live streaming webinars. And since most veterinary tech and technologist degrees require clinical training, that portion can typically be fulfilled as an internship or work study program at a local Muscoy CA veterinary practice or hospital. Distance learning, as it is also called, can in many instances lower the cost of your education. Tuition and ancillary expenditures, for example for commuting and study materials, can be more affordable compared to more traditional classroom courses. Just make sure that the online school that you choose is accredited, either by the AVMA or another nationally certified accrediting organization. With the online courses and the practical training, everything is furnished for a complete education. So if you are disciplined enough to learn in this more independent manner, an online veterinary technician program may be the ideal choice for you.

Things to Ask Vet Tech Programs

Muscoy California cat in portable kennel in veterinary hospitalBy now you should have selected which veterinarian credential that you wish to obtain, and if you want to study online or attend a school on campus. Since there are an abundance of veterinary community colleges, vocational and trade schools in the Muscoy CA area as well as across the Country, you should ask some important questions in order to narrow down your list of options. As we discussed in our introduction, many prospective students start by focusing on location and the cost of tuition. But we have previously touched on other significant qualifiers, such as internship programs and accreditation. And naturally you want to choose a college that offers the specialty and degree that you are interested in. These and other factors are reviewed in the list of questions that you need to ask the vet tech colleges that you are looking at.

Is the Veterinary Program Accredited?  It's important that you verify that the vet tech school you select is accredited by a regional or national accrediting organization. As earlier mentioned, one of the most highly regarded is the American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A). Vocational schools and colleges that are accredited by the AVMA have gone through an extensive review process that confirms you will obtain a superior education. Also, accreditation is essential if you are requesting a student loan or financial aid, since many programs are not obtainable for non-accredited programs. Last, having a certificate or degree from an accredited school is in many cases a precondition for employment for many Muscoy CA area veterinary clinics and hospitals.

What is the School's Reputation?  The veterinarian college or trade school and program you enroll in should have an outstanding reputation within the vet community. You can begin your due diligence by asking the schools you are reviewing for testimonials from the employers in their job placement network. Other tips include checking with online school ranking websites and speaking with the school's accrediting agencies as well. You can ask the California school licensing authority if there have been any complaints or infractions involving your targeted schools. As a final tip, phone some Muscoy CA veterinary clinics that you may want to work for after you go through your training. Find out what they think about your school selections. They might even suggest some schools not on your list.

Are there Internship Programs?  The best approach to obtain practical hands on training as a vet tech is to work in a clinical environment. Find out if the programs you are considering have internship programs established with Muscoy CA veterinarians, vet hospitals or clinics. Almost all veterinary medicine programs mandate clinical training and a large number furnish it through internships. Not only will the experience be beneficial as far as the clinical training, but an internship may also help build relationships in the local veterinary community and help in the search for employment after graduation.

Is Job Placement Offered?  Searching for a job after graduating from a vet tech school can be challenging without the assistance of a job placement program. To start with, ask what the graduation rates are for the schools you are considering. A lower rate could signify that the instructors were unqualified to teach the curriculum or that some students were unhappy with the program and quit. Next, confirm that the colleges have a job assistance program and ask what their placement rates are. A higher placement rate could indicate that the program has an excellent reputation within the Muscoy CA veterinarian community and has a substantial network of contacts for student placements. A lower rate may indicate that the training is not well regarded by employers or that the job placement program is ineffective at placing students.

How Big are the Classes?  If the classes are bigger, you most likely will get little or no individualized instruction from the teachers. Find out from the Muscoy CA programs you are considering what their classroom teacher to student ratios are. You might also want to attend some classes (if practical) to monitor the interaction between teachers and students. Ask for feedback from students concerning the quality of instruction. Also, talk with the instructors and determine what their backgrounds are as well as their methods of teaching.

Where is the College Located?  Okay, we already covered location, but there are several more points to make on the topic. If you are planning to commute to your vet tech classes from your Muscoy CA home, you have to confirm that the driving time is compatible with your schedule. For example, driving during the weekend to check out the route won't be the same as the drive during rush hour traffic, particularly if the college is located near or in a large city. In addition, if you do choose to attend a college in another state or even outside of your County of residence, there may be increased tuition charges especially for community and state colleges. On the other hand, attending online classes might be an alternative that will provide you with more flexibility and reduce the need for travel.

Is the Class Schedule Flexible?  And finally, it's imperative that you ascertain if the veterinary schools you are exploring offer class times flexible enough to fit your schedule. For instance, a number of students continue working full time and can only go to classes on the weekends or in the evenings near Muscoy CA. Others may only be able to go to classes in the morning or in the afternoon. Make certain that the class times you need are offered before enrolling. Also, determine if you can make-up classes that you might miss because of work, illness or family issues. You may find that an online school is the ideal solution to fit your vet training into your active life.
